Output be32965bd74f853829ee6c70738775404e04ade0442867ec4b63b730222db0bc:3

value
68985554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757d627352ccc907e42d1b1dcef78e2d319f8363 OP_EQUAL
address
3CQFBrsiAGfa9kytikTiaTpNyonjYPsrh8
transaction
be32965bd74f853829ee6c70738775404e04ade0442867ec4b63b730222db0bc
spent
true